Use these buttons to control the action to be taken for
the devices listed:
Select Allow All to ignore the Managed Devices
list and let all devices connect to the CODA-551x.
Select Allow Listed to permit only devices you
added to the Managed Devices list to access the
CODA-551x and the network. All other devices are
denied access.
Select Block Listed to permit all devices except
those you added to the Managed Devices list to
access the CODA-551x and the network. The
specified devices are denied access.
